Paintless Dent Repair is a collection of techniques for removing minor dents and dings from the body of a motor vehicle. This includes the repair of hail damage, door dings, minor body creases, and minor bumper indentations. PDR is most suitable for minor body damage where the paint is not affected. However, PDR techniques can also be applied to help prepare the damaged panel for paint. Limiting factors for a successful repair using PDR include the flexibility of the paint, and the amount the metal has been stretched by the damage incurred. Hence, often extremely sharp dents and creases may not be repairable- at least not without painting afterwards.
It's important to note, Paintless dent repair takes time to learn; it is more of an art than a specific set of skills. The ability to successfully remove dents and dings is learned through trial and error. An untrained individual can actually damage a dent if attempting a repair without the correct skills and knowledge.
